Enum tor_socksproto::SocksAuth
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ub enum SocksAuth {
NoAuth,
Socks4(Vec<u8>),
Username(Vec<u8>, Vec<u8>),
}
Expand description
Provided authentication from a SOCKS handshake
Variants (Non-exhaustive)§
This enum is marked as non-exhaustive
Non-exhaustive enums could have additional variants added in future. Therefore, when matching against variants of non-exhaustive enums, an extra wildcard arm must be added to account for any future variants.
NoAuth
No authentication was provided
Socks4(Vec<u8>)
Socks4 authentication (a string) was provided.
Username(Vec<u8>, Vec<u8>)
Socks5 username/password authentication was provided.
